The aim of this study was to investigate the relationship between social desirability, self-esteem and happiness among female high school students in the city of Joibar. This study was classified as a descriptive-correlational study in terms of method and fundamental in terms of purpose. The statistical population consisted of 778 female students, 247 of whom were selected through stratified random sampling using the Gregsey and Morgan table. The data collection tools were the Oxford Happiness Inventory (OHI) and the Cooper Smith Self-Esteem Inventory (SEI). The data were analyzed using descriptive and inferential statistics. The results showed that there was a positive and significant relationship between social desirability and both self-esteem and happiness variables. It was also found that social desirability has a significant relationship with all dimensions of self-esteem and happiness. According to the findings, among the happiness subscales, the greatest effect was related to life satisfaction and the least effect was related to control. In the field of self-esteem, the results also indicated that all four dimensions of self-esteem had a positive effect on social desirability, with the greatest effect observed for family self-esteem and the least effect observed for social self-esteem.
